    Top Types of Enhanced Acca Offers

    Bookmakers employ various methods to enhance accumulator bets. Here are the most prevalent and beneficial types:

    • Acca Boosts (Winnings Boosts): This is the most common and sought-after form of enhanced acca offer. Bookmakers add a percentage bonus to your winnings if your accumulator is successful. The percentage typically scales with the number of legs in your acca (e.g., 5% extra for a 3-fold, 10% for a 4-fold, up to 50% or even 70% for 10+ folds). These boosts are usually paid as cash on top of your standard winnings, making them incredibly valuable for direct profit.
    • Acca Insurance: This offer provides a crucial safety net. If only one leg of your accumulator lets you down, the bookmaker refunds your stake, typically as a free bet (but sometimes as cash). For example, a “5-fold acca insurance” means if you place a bet with five selections and four win, you get your stake back, softening the blow of a near miss.
    • Multi-Bet Specific Price Boosts: Beyond general price boosts, some bookmakers will offer significantly enhanced odds on pre-selected accumulator combinations, often for popular weekend fixtures or major tournaments. These are ready-made, high-value bets that save you the effort of building your own.
    • Early Payout for Accas: While rarer, a few bookmakers might extend their early payout features to accumulators. If all legs of your multi-bet are winning by a certain margin (e.g., all teams are two goals up in football) at any point, your entire acca is settled as a winner, regardless of the final results. This is a fantastic offer for volatile matches.
    • Bet Builder Enhancements: With the rise of custom “Bet Builders” (same-game parlays), some bookmakers offer boosted odds or free bets when you create a multi-market bet on a single match.

    Key Terms and Conditions to Scrutinize

    To truly benefit from enhanced acca offers, always read the full terms and conditions meticulously:

    • Minimum/Maximum Legs: The required number of selections for your acca to qualify for the boost or insurance.
    • Minimum Odds per Leg/Overall: Any minimum odds requirements for individual selections or the overall accumulator.
    • Eligible Markets/Sports: Restrictions on which sports or markets qualify (e.g., football only, match result market only).
    • Maximum Bonus/Refund: The cap on the extra winnings or refund amount.
    • Payout Type: Is the boost or refund in cash or free bets? If free bets, understand their expiry and usage terms (e.g., stake not returned).
    • Cash Out: Often, using the cash-out feature will void the acca bonus.
